Output 2891b597522407034122cd8ff62479e5b24221b1a3dddeee516fe9f4dc3a8adb:112

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ee4d74987e9810cb67dd36f348480ecb12c69f18082bbe78602c58f1a5b6e64c
address
bc1paexhfxr7nqgvke7axme5sjqwevfvd8ccpq4mu7rq93v0rfdkuexq037xs4
transaction
2891b597522407034122cd8ff62479e5b24221b1a3dddeee516fe9f4dc3a8adb
confirmations
10876
spent
true